Grateful Dead
Alpine Valley Music Theater  - East Troy, Wisc. 
Friday - July 6th, 1984
-----------------------------------------------
Recorded by The Weasel - "Da Weez"
Transferred and mastered to .wav files by D5scott
source: 2 Beyer M160 & 1 Sennheiser 421 microphones > Nak MX100 w/2001 > Sony TC-D5M (Dolby on) - analog master cassettes 
transfer: Sony TC-D5M (original record deck - Dolby on) > Pre Sonus Inspire GT > Sound Forge > .wav files > Trader's Little Helper > flac and ffp files
